Dekkle Fine Art Atelier & Printmaking Studio
Follow us

Search

Landscape 1, Madura
  -    -    -    -  Landscape 1, Madura

Landscape 1, Madura

Works on Paper
Indonesia
H127mm x W171mm

Date:

Tags: